Case summaries
Austria: Federal Administrative Court (BVwG), 25. June 2018, W209 2184750-
Country of applicant:
Bangladesh
Keywords:
Reception conditions, Access to the labour market
In direct application of Art. 15 (2) of the Reception Conditions Directive, according to which asylum applicants must be given effective access to the labour market, the requirements of the Act Governing the Employment of Foreign Nationals (AuslBG) must be modified. The non-existence of a unanimous approval by the Regional Council pursuant to Art. 4 (3) AuslBG does not preclude the granting of employment permits to asylum applicants.
